Description
Join Northeast Georgia Health System, a not-for-profit healthcare system, as their new Accreditation Director!
The Position
- The Accreditation Director will lead system-wide accreditation and continuous readiness efforts across acute care hospitals and hospital outpatient departments, including CMS, DNV, state regulations, and ISO standards.
- The Director will be responsible for the oversight of approximately five FTEs and will oversee accreditation readiness activities, including survey preparation, findings management, action planning, and resolution tracking.
- Partner with nursing, operations, Risk Management, and other departments to proactively identify improvement opportunities and ensure ongoing survey readiness
- This leader will direct system-wide policy and document control functions, including oversight of the Policy Steering Committee and standardization of documentation practices.
- The Director will strive to maintain strategic and operational oversight of the Quality Management System (QMS) and document control systems across Acute Care Services.
- Lead and develop the Accreditation, Policy, and Document Control teams, including coaching, performance management, and competency oversight.
- This leader will collaborate with Executive Leadership leadership on budgeting, resource planning, and system-level accreditation priorities and goals.
- Serve as a lean leader, promoting continuous improvement and supporting organizational excellence initiatives, while completing special projects as assigned.
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ree is required.
- Active RN license is required.
- A minimum of five years of progressive care experience within an acute care setting is required.
- A minimum of five years’ experience of accreditation or related experience is required.

The Community
- Gainesville is best known for its proximity to Lake Lanier, one of Georgia’s premier destinations for boating, fishing, camping, and waterfront recreation. The city also features a revitalized historic downtown, the Quinlan Visual Arts Center, and scenic outdoor destinations like the Elachee Nature Science Center and nearby Blue Ridge foothills. Gainesville is often referred to as the “Queen City of the Mountains” due to its location in North Georgia’s rolling landscape.
- Gainesville is served by both the Gainesville City School District and portions of the Hall County School District, with schools known for strong academics, athletics, and fine arts programs. Gainesville High School has a long-standing reputation for academic and athletic excellence, while the area also offers higher education opportunities through the University of North Georgia – Gainesville Campus and Lanier Technical College.
- Gainesville is internationally recognized as the “Poultry Capital of the World,” serving as a major hub for the poultry industry and food production throughout the Southeast. In addition to its industrial presence, the city has become known for its balance of outdoor recreation, economic growth, healthcare expansion, and vibrant community culture.
- Residents are drawn to Gainesville for its welcoming, family-oriented atmosphere and strong sense of community. The city offers a mix of small-town Southern charm and modern growth, with year-round festivals, local shops, parks, and recreation programs contributing to a highly active lifestyle. Convenient access to Atlanta combined with mountain and lake scenery makes Gainesville a desirable place for both families and professionals.
